Output efb43f9f78bde6a024e98b79a338bc4c997a17a6ffad618d69ef5d6a74c09566:1

value
3580022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58fc89f01bf9b4fa640a469fcf7439e414306f36 OP_EQUAL
address
39oXv8URzmihww95ACiUnrNvCZcXMHGzwt
transaction
efb43f9f78bde6a024e98b79a338bc4c997a17a6ffad618d69ef5d6a74c09566
spent
true